Shops in Redhill town centre have been forced to close on one of the busiest shopping days of the year following a power cut. Clinton Cards, Santander, Carphone Warehouse and Poundland, in the Warwick Quadrant, are currently closed because of the power cut, caused by a fault with an underground cable.
